davy jones Posted August 12, 2004 #2 Share Posted August 12, 2004 Jim, The dock in Nassau is adjacent to the downtown area. There will be many ship passengers doing the same, because there will probably be other ships in port at the same time. It's pretty much shopping downtown. There are a few bar/restaurants (Senor Frogs, Hard Rock Cafe). The beaches are a short cab ride from the pier. The taxis are fine.
